The Background
China and Australia have a long-standing economic relationship, with China being one of Australia's largest trading partners. However, tensions began to rise in 2019 when Australia called for an independent inquiry into the origin of the COVID-19 pandemic. This move was met with criticism from the Chinese government, who saw it as an attempt to undermine their reputation.
As a result, China imposed trade restrictions on various Australian products, including beef, wine, and barley. This had a significant impact on the Australian economy, with many industries suffering losses as a result.
